当前位置:首页>维修大全>综合>

忘记Linux的用户名或密码怎么办(linux找回登录密码)

忘记Linux的用户名或密码怎么办(linux找回登录密码)

更新时间:2025-07-13 05:19:47

忘记Linux的用户名或密码怎么办

如果你忘记了Linux的用户名或密码,可以尝试以下方法:

找回用户名。在终端中执行以下命令,将列出所有用户名:

cat /etc/passwd | cut -d: -f1 | grep -v nobody

找回密码。如果忘记了root密码,可以尝试以下步骤:

在出现grub画面时,用上下键选中你平时启动Linux的那一项,然后按e键。

选中类似于kernel /boot/vmlinuz-2.4.18-14 ro root=LABEL=/的那一项,然后按e键。

在命令行中加入single,修改后的命令行如下:

kernel /boot/vmlinuz-2.4.18-14 single ro root=LABEL=/

回车返回,然后按b键启动,即可直接进入Linux命令行。

使用 vi /etc/shadow 命令将第一行,即以root开头的一行中 root: 后和下一个 : 前的内容删除,修改完后按B键,启动后进入命令行,通过命令行修改密码即可。

1. 使用root用户登录:如果您有root用户的权限,可以使用root用户登录系统,然后修改其他用户的密码或创建新的用户。

2. 使用恢复模式:在系统启动时,选择恢复模式,进入单用户模式。在这种模式下,您可以使用root权限修改密码或创建新用户。

3. 使用Live CD:使用Linux Live CD启动计算机,然后挂载系统分区,修改密码或创建新用户。

需要注意的是,这些方法可能需要一定的技术和操作经验,并且可能会对系统造成不良影响。因此,在尝试这些方法之前,建议备份重要数据,并谨慎操作。

更多栏目